We're looking for our Founding Product Manager (PM), our first non-technical hire, who will translate ambiguous customer pain points into crisp product bets, drive 0โ1 execution, and help define the product category for AI-native time-series.
The Role
Own 0โ1: Translate raw, technical, and often ambiguous customer needs into sharp product hypotheses, ship fast, and validate impact.
Be the Connector: Work hand-in-hand with world-class engineers, researchers, and lighthouse customers to validate and scale winning patterns.
Grow into Leadership: Stand up lightweight product processes now, then build and lead the PM function as we scale into the next stage.
First 6โ12 months (IC focus):
- Own product planning, roadmap, and execution in close collaboration with engineering, sales, legal and market
- Partner with early customers to validate hypotheses, prioritize features, and iterate quickly
- Drive new customer discovery through cold outreach, user research, etc.
- Introduce lightweight product processes (sprints, specs, internal tooling) to support execution
- Contribute to go-to-market strategy planning
- Metrics & KPIs: define clear, measurable KPIs for product success (user acquisition, engagement, retention, and overall product impact)
- Transition to product leadership as we grow

What we're looking for:
- 4โ7 years of product experience, ideally in early-stage startups or deep tech / B2B / ML / dev tools
- Startup mindset: thrives in ambiguity and moves with urgency. Bias for action โ builds fast, ships MVPs, and learns from real-world usage. Works side-by-side with engineering and design to iterate quickly, adjust course based on customer feedback and early market signals, and continuously refine product-market fit
- Strong technical fluency โ comfortable working with technical engineers and researchers (no coding required)
- Experience building early-stage products from zero, with a bias for fast, thoughtful execution
- Excellent communication skills and ability to shape clear product narratives
- Hands-on with customer discovery and prioritization
- Ambitious and driven โ wants to build, not just manage
